Killed in action. DORSETSHIRE and her sister ship Cornwall were detached from the Fleet when they were sighted by Japanese aircraft. A little later they were overwhelmed by approximately 50 dive-bombers whose accurate attack sank both ships quickly; 190 of Cornwall's crew of 650 were lost
Son of Arthur and Jane Orton, of Dover Road, Sea Point, Cape Province. Husband of Lilian Edith Nadina Orton, of Harfield Road, Claremont, Cape Province
